Tribute to Arthur C. clarke who passed away recently.
He will be remembered not only for his imaginative science fiction
but also his non-fiction scientific work.
Check out the Wiki page is you're interested:
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Arthur_C._Clarke

Some quotes of his that I like:

"One cannot have superior science and inferior morals.
The combination is unstable and self-destroying."

"I'm sure the universe is full of intelligent life.
It's just been too intelligent to come here."

"Two possibilities exist: Either we are alone in the Universe
or we are not. Both are equally terrifying."
